Interesting. This recipe works straight out of the box for me (despite
the problems reported on the cookbook page).

Here's what's in my wikipage:

%width=600 height=600%http://openclipart.org/people/mrallowski/1334869889.svg"Green
earth SVG image for environmentally friendly custard"

(That's all on one line, by the way, I'm sure email is going to cause
it to wrap.)

The image is displayed fine when the page is rendered.

What is not working, apparently, is the caption is hung off to the
side as the image is rendered inline, unlike how it is done for a
gif/png/jpg, giving a tool tip. Given it's doing an embed instead of
an img, this may be problematic. It doesn't look to me as though
chrome or firefox do tooltips for title= attributes in an embed tag.
